What is an NPU? Sounds like a fad
Neural processing unit, it enhances various algorithmic actions or AI processing. For example, a non-generative use of an NPU is when your Pixel phone lets you remove objects in Google Photos or faster H264 decoding on an Apple Silicon Macbook. Time has yet to tell how valuable they will be (given the AI craze is just a bubble waiting to burst), they aren't new, but AMD and Intel have been slow to add them or were forced to by Microsoft.
